STATE v. WRIGHT

80-515.

409 So.2d 795 (1982)

STATE of Alabama v. Jeanette W. WRIGHT and W. T. Weathers.

Supreme Court of Alabama.

January 22, 1982.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John A. Tinney, Roanoke, for appellant.

Andrew W. Bolt, II of Wilson, Bolt, Isom, Jackson & Bailey, Anniston, for appellees.


JONES, Justice.

This is an appeal from an adverse declaratory judgment holding that Appellant State of Alabama is required to purchase the right of way across Appellees' property.
